Brief History[edit | edit source]

The 9th Regiment, Michigan infantry was organized at Detroit Michigan and mustered in October 15, 1861. It was mustered out: September 15, 1865. Discharged at: Detroit, Michigan, September 26, 1865. [1]

Companies in this Regiment with the Counties of Origin[edit | edit source]

Men often enlisted in  a company recruited in the counties where they lived though not always. After many battles, companies might be combined because so many men were killed or wounded.  However if you are unsure which company your ancestor  was in, try the company recruited in his county first.

Company A - Many men from Macomb County - see  Roster
Company B - Many men from Berrien County and Cass County - see Roster
Company C - Many men from Jackson County - see Roster
Company D - Many men from Ionia County - see Roster
Company E - Many men from Wayne County - see Roster
Company F - Many men from Calhoun County and Shiawassee County - see Roster
Company G - Many men from Branch County - see Roster
Company H - Many men from Ionia County - see Roster
Company I - Many men from Macomb County and Livingston County - see Roster
Company K - Many men from Livingston County - see Roster
Unassigned Company - Many men from Jackson County - see Roster
See Rosters, as there were men from many different Counties in these Companies
